If you want … WebBuy a new hot water bottle every year. Hot water bottles that are in good condition on the outside may be damaged on the inside. Check the daisy wheel date when buying a new bottle and note the year of manufacture. If it is more than 3 years old and/or appears aged or faded, don’t buy it. Safe use.
